on this issue vs in this issue

The correct phrase that's needed here is 'on this issue.' It's the commonly used prepositional phrase to refer to talking about or addressing a specific topic or matter. 'In this issue' isn't typically used in this context.

on this issue

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

Use 'on this issue' when referring to discussing or addressing a specific topic or matter.

Examples:

  • I would like to share my thoughts on this issue.
  • There are differing opinions on this issue.
  • Let's focus on this issue during the meeting.
  • What is your stance on this issue?
  • We need to find a solution on this issue.

Alternatives:

  • regarding this issue
  • concerning this issue
  • about this issue
  • related to this issue
  • in relation to this issue

in this issue

This phrase is not commonly used in English in this context.
